Subject: DR drill — dedup pipeline. Ren: Saturday's drill restores the Calvane customer store and reruns the Mirrow dedup pass against it. Hold all releases touching customer records until the merge report is signed off. Expect duplicate-count alerts during the run; ignore them. Results land in the drill folder by noon. The restore console unlocks with the recovery passphrase below.

vault phrase of fahog-yajog = frawyn-jordor-casael-gormir-olieth-julmir

Handover note for Parcelwatch, our typo-squatting package scanner. It polls the Nimbria registry feed hourly, computes edit-distance matches against our internal package list, and files alerts above the similarity threshold. The Levenshtein cutoff is deliberately conservative; raise it only with review. Nightly full rescans run at 02:00 and are safe to interrupt. Before making any changes, please confirm the scanner is running with the expected settings, shown here.

deployment values, yadug-bawif:
[framir]
team = pelox
access_code = ac_a38ab2
owner = tamion.julael
host = framir.tolvaqlabs.test
port = 11211
peer = tammir.zemvargrid.local
salt = 2215ef03
pin = 1541

### Account Recovery — Glyphcart Font Vendoring

If the vendoring bot's account on the Typesmith mirror is locked, third-party font updates for the Harrowgate release will stall. Recovery requires two steps: verify the lockout in the mirror's admin log, then re-authenticate the bot using the recovery passphrase, which is recorded immediately below for the on-call engineer.

unlock words, kahif-bajep: druix-sormir-fenys

Ticket: Tracing config drift between Hollowmere services

For review: while auditing request tracing, I found the sampling and propagation settings have drifted across our microservices. Ferrel and Ledgerbird still use the old header format, so traces break at that boundary and spans arrive orphaned in the Wrenview collector. This change pins every service to a single shared tracing config, sourced from the platform repo. The canonical values, which all services must now adopt, follow.

config for bahop-fajep:
DRUATH_PIN=4501
DRUATH_TENANT=briwyn
DRUATH_METRICS_HOST=metrics.druath.brasksoft.test
DRUATH_SEAL=seal_7d2e069d
DRUATH_STANDBY_TEAM=olieth